From our sommeliers

The Viognier from Belvento belongs to the line of Sea Wines from the Petra winery. It is made from fresh and fragrant grapes that come from the clay and sandy soils of Maremma Toscana, just a few kilometers from the sea. It has a typically savory and fruity profile, with a crisp and juicy body, wrapped in notes of citrus, white fruit, and floral essences.

The Viognier Belvento is a label that wonderfully synthesizes the fortunate union between the terroir of the Tuscan coast and a famous French grape variety, native to the Rhône Valley. In the Mediterranean, sunny, and marine climate of the Tuscan Maremma, the Viognier expresses itself with a profile pleasantly fruity and saline. The intense and rich aromas, typical of the varietal character of the grape, are enriched with hints of Mediterranean scrub and iodine memories, which give the wine a refined expressive elegance.

The Viognier wine, made by Belvento, originates from the Tuscan estate owned by the Moretti family, famous for the Franciacorta winery Bellavista. The Viognier vineyards have an average age of about twelve years and are planted in a hilly area, in a context dominated by the spontaneous vegetation of the Mediterranean scrub, on clayey-sandy soils, with the presence of limestone. The place is particularly favorable for viticulture, thanks to a mild, typically Mediterranean climate, characterized by the influence of the breezes from the Tyrrhenian Sea.Tirreno.  The grapes are hand-picked at full ripeness and after a selection of the best bunches made in the winery, a soft pressing follows. The free-run must ferments in temperature-controlled stainless steel tanks, with classic white winemaking. Before bottling, the wine matures for several months in steel tanks.

The white Viognier, produced by the Belvento brand of the Petra winery, is a bottle with a pleasantly fruity and smooth character. It is a perfect label to enjoy during an aperitif or to pair with seafood appetizers or a delicate fish menu. In the glass, it has a light straw-yellow color, bright and luminous. The aromatic profile is elegant and multifaceted, with floral scents, hints of aromatic herbs, sage, rosemary, citrus fragrances, cedar zest, aromas of cartucciaro melon, white peach, and delicate notes of tropical fruit. The sip is rich and soft, with a ripe and juicy fruit, well balanced by a fresh and savory finish.
